Mr. Alvaro de Souza, 56 years old, holds a Bachelor's degree in Economics and Business Administration. He is the former CEO (1) (Chief Executive Officer) The highest individual in command of an organization. Typically the president of the company, the CEO reports to the Chairman of the Board.  of Citibank in Brazil and is a member of the Board of Directors of Comgas, British Gas and Roland Berger.

Antonio Kandir, 51 years old, holds Bachelor's and Master's degrees in Economics from UNICAMP UNICAMP Universidade de Campinas (Campinas, São Paulo State, Brazil)  and a production engineering degree from Politecnica -- SP. He served in the Brazilian Government as a Congressional Representative for 2 terms, as well as Planning and Budget Minister and Chairman of the Privatization Council. He is currently Partner and Director of Banco Ribeirao Preto and member of the Board of Directors of AVIPAL/ELEGE, Cecrisa, Portugal Telecom and Jacklinks Brasil.

About GOL Linhas Aereas Inteligentes

GOL Linhas Aereas Inteligentes, a "low-cost, low-fare" airline, is one of the most profitable airlines in the industry worldwide. GOL operates a simplified fleet with a single-class of service and has one of the youngest and most modern fleets in the industry, leading to low maintenance, fuel and training costs, and therefore high aircraft utilization and efficiency ratios. Add to this safe and reliable service, stimulating GOL's brand recognition and customer satisfaction, and GOL has the best cost-benefit service in the market. GOL offers service to all major business and travel destinations in Brazil, with substantial expansion opportunities. In 2004, GOL plans to grow by increasing frequencies in existing markets and adding service to additional markets in both Brazil and other high-traffic South American travel destinations. Gol went public on the NYSE and the Bovespa in June 2004.
